Petrol stations selling low-quality gasoline identified
Uzenergoinspeksiya prevented the sale of low-quality gasoline at petrol stations.
Photo: uzenergoinspeksiya.uz
The control and chemical laboratory of Uzenergoinspeksiya under the Ministry of Energy, during a raid to control the quality of petroleum products, identified 25 cases of low-quality gasoline being sold at petrol stations in the first quarter of this year.
It is noted that experts discovered 262 thousand liters of low-quality gasoline, preventing its sale.
Based on identified cases, instructions were given to restore product quality and their implementation was monitored.
